About the Turks and Caicos Islands
The Turks and Caicos Islands are home to over 40 islands and cays. Each island has its own stunning landscapes and a rich history. The geography is known for its pristine beaches, vibrant coral reefs, and lush vegetation.
Visitors from all over the world come to see these wonders. The islands mix British and Caribbean cultures, making them unique.
The Geography and Cultural Background
Grace Bay Beach is famous, named the best beach in the world in 2022. It’s a 7-mile stretch of soft, white sand. The third-largest barrier reef surrounds the islands, perfect for snorkeling and diving.
Grand Turk is the second-most populated island and a cultural hub. It has the Turks and Caicos National Museum at two locations. The Middle Caicos Co-op showcases art from over 60 local artisans.
Climate and Best Time to Visit
The Turks and Caicos Islands have a tropical savanna climate. The best time to visit is from December to April, the dry season. This time is perfect for outdoor activities like horseback riding and exploring marine wetlands.
The annual humpback whale migration from January to April makes this season even more special. It attracts many tourists.
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Number of Islands | Over 40 islands and cays |
| Best Beach | Grace Bay Beach, named best in the world in 2022 |
| Barrier Reef | Third largest in the world, approximately 340 miles long |
| Cultural Significance | Rich blend of British and Caribbean influences |
| Peak Season | December to April, during the dry season |
Must-See Islands in the Turks and Caicos
The Turks and Caicos Islands are full of stunning places. Each island has its own charm and attractions. You can explore bustling streets, rich history, and breathtaking landscapes.
Providenciales: The Main Hub
Providenciales is home to many popular spots. The famous Grace Bay Beach is a must-see. It has soft white sand and clear waters perfect for relaxation and water sports.
The island also offers great food, luxury stays, and lively nights. There’s always something fun to do here.
Grand Turk: The Historical Capital
Grand Turk is great for history buffs. It has colonial buildings and museums that tell its story. The Turks and Caicos National Museum is a must-visit.
It showcases the region’s history and culture through artifacts. It’s a deep dive into the past.
North Caicos and Middle Caicos: Nature Lovers’ Paradise
North and Middle Caicos are perfect for nature lovers. These islands are untouched, offering lush landscapes to explore. Nature tours here reveal amazing sights like Mudjin Harbour and the Conch Bar Caves.
These places are home to unique wildlife. You can also enjoy peaceful beaches like Sandy Point and Little Ambergris Cay. They offer a serene escape.

Explore the Conch Bar Caves
The Conch Bar Caves in Middle Caicos are a must-see for Turks and Caicos sightseeing. This cave system is filled with stunning stalactites and ancient petroglyphs. It’s perfect for those who love adventure and history.
Guided tours are available. They share fascinating stories about the caves’ geological wonders and their cultural importance.
Visit the Turks and Caicos National Museum
The Turks and Caicos National Museum in Grand Turk is a treasure trove of history and culture. It showcases the islands’ marine environment and rich heritage. The exhibits are engaging and informative, making it a great place to learn about the islands’ roots.

Cultural Experiences in Turks and Caicos
Dive into the vibrant culture of the Turks and Caicos Islands. Join local festivals and explore historic sites. Each experience offers a peek into the islands’ rich culture and history.
Participate in Local Festivals
Joining Turks and Caicos festivals is a unique way to see the islands’ culture. Dance to traditional tunes, taste local dishes, and watch colorful parades. Events like Junkanoo festivals celebrate heritage and unite the community, making your trip memorable.
Visit Historic Sites in Grand Turk
Grand Turk boasts historic sites that reveal the islands’ colonial past. The Turks and Caicos National Museum showcases artifacts from a thousand years ago. Cockburn Town’s British colonial buildings, including the Old Lighthouse, offer a glimpse into history. These sites enrich your understanding of Turks and Caicos’ cultural heritage.
| Festival | Time of Year | Highlights |
|---|---|---|
| Junkanoo Festival | Boxing Day & New Year’s | Colorful costumes, traditional music, dancing |
| Conch Festival | November | Gastronomic delights featuring conch, live music |
| National Heritage Month | October | Local arts and crafts, cultural exhibitions |
Eco-Tourism Opportunities
Discover the beauty of Turks and Caicos through eco-tourism. The islands offer unique spots for adventure and discovery. Kayaking and birdwatching let you see wildlife and stunning views.
Exploring the Mangroves by Kayak
Guided kayaking tours show off the mangrove ecosystems. You’ll paddle through lush areas, hearing nature’s sounds. Look out for sharks, sea turtles, and fish.
The Big Blue Collective near the Princess Alexandra Nature Reserve has many kayaks and paddleboards. They help you explore fully.
Birdwatching and Wildlife Tours
North Caicos is great for birdwatchers. You might see flamingos, great egrets, and ospreys. These tours let you connect with the local ecosystem.
| Eco-Tourism Activities | Highlights | Best Locations |
|---|---|---|
| Kayaking Tours | Explore mangroves, observe marine life | Princess Alexandra Nature Reserve |
| Birdwatching | Spot native and migratory birds | North Caicos |
| Wildlife Tours | Observe endangered species like the Turks and Caicos Rock Iguana | Little Water Cay, Mangrove Cay |
| Guided Sailing Tours | Discover coastal ecosystems and wildlife | Chalk Sound National Park |

Best Transportation Options Between Islands
There are many ways to travel around the Turks and Caicos. Ferries are a great choice for going between places like Providenciales and North Caicos. Private charters let you set your own schedule, which is handy.
For a faster option, small planes are available. They offer quick trips between islands and amazing views from the sky.
